diff options
author | Boris Kolpackov <boris@codesynthesis.com> | 2011-06-02 04:30:34 +0200 |
---|---|---|
committer | Boris Kolpackov <boris@codesynthesis.com> | 2011-06-02 04:30:34 +0200 |
commit | fbe57707af97fdc63a00209db54e62d46e4ffbff (patch) | |
tree | 1d294db62e22cb0e1ce74e048ceac4eb58267332 /xsd-frontend/semantic-graph/elements.hxx | |
parent | 4d713efd879b0f2edec03d1a9bdc430b19681515 (diff) |
Add accessor for facet map
Diffstat (limited to 'xsd-frontend/semantic-graph/elements.hxx')
-rw-r--r-- | xsd-frontend/semantic-graph/elements.hxx | 9 |
1 files changed, 7 insertions, 2 deletions
diff --git a/xsd-frontend/semantic-graph/elements.hxx b/xsd-frontend/semantic-graph/elements.hxx index d92841b..9bf0462 100644 --- a/xsd-frontend/semantic-graph/elements.hxx +++ b/xsd-frontend/semantic-graph/elements.hxx @@ -862,12 +862,11 @@ namespace XSDFrontend class Restricts: public virtual Inherits { - protected: + public: typedef Cult::Containers::Map<WideString, WideString> Facets; - public: typedef Facets::Iterator FacetIterator; @@ -902,6 +901,12 @@ namespace XSDFrontend facets_[name] = value; } + Facets const& + facets () const + { + return facets_; + } + protected: friend class Bits::Graph<Node, Edge>; |